Descriptive phrase: older-townie club. I’d heard that The Lucky Rabbit used to be a sort of local dive. But when we heard it had undergone an internal remodel, we figured to give it a go. Sitting a bit by itself on a main corner on the river in downtown Waukesha, the building it’s housed in is actually pretty and classic. Once you step inside, though, it’s all modern-chic. The first thing we noticed was the blaring music. Loud, nothing else to it. The first room has a large U bar with TVs and a few video-poker games(read: classy). There was a respectable selection of craft beer on tap, though the bartenders were all very young and a bit slow. There was also a large main room, split into lounge seating, a big dance floor, and a space with pool. We steered clear of this area as it appeared even louder and housed a lot of people. At this point you’d be forgiven for thinking you were on Cathedral Square in downtown Milwaukee. But looking around, at least on this Saturday night, we noticed that we were the youngest in the bar by at least 10 years. The clientele seemed to range from the suburban 30-somethings looking to unwind to 50-year old bikers who were regulars before the remodel. The Lucky Rabbit is a beautiful space and a fine watering hole, but fist-pumping 38-year-olds ain’t my scene(yet).
